Do Palestine Citizens Need a Visa for Syria?
E-Visa
Visa Status
E-Visa
Notes
Palestinians whose their Palestinian Authority Passport states that they were born in Algeria, Bahrain, Jordan, Kuwait, Lebanon, Mauritania, Morocco, Oman, Qatar, Saudi Arabia, Somalia, Sudan, Syria, Tunisia, United Arab Emirates or Yemen do not need a visa.
Nationals of countries without any Syrian representation can obtain a visa upon arrival,
Palestinians with a residence permit issued by a GCC country state can obtain a visa upon arrival. They must have a valid address in Syria, a contact number and sufficient funds to cover their stay.
